Transaction 12886f7110ac8e56ac2dae25f713cd20a8d4fa37df602aee60697b83dc4e30cc

1 Input
2 Outputs
  • 12886f7110ac8e56ac2dae25f713cd20a8d4fa37df602aee60697b83dc4e30cc:0
  • value  1542654
    address  3Nc6F4XjRQSpzFQUhrBSDK9EZXG9n2LMad
  • 12886f7110ac8e56ac2dae25f713cd20a8d4fa37df602aee60697b83dc4e30cc:1
  • value  742301540
    address  bc1qzj7zwq5wak50lmsm72lr47a07j8eqepvfjrass